Image processing service system
An image processing service system includes an operation request accepting unit, a setting accepting unit, a payment control unit, and an operation execution control unit. The operation request accepting unit accepts an operation request for an image processing apparatus through a chat between a user and a chatbot participating in a chat service on a chat board provided by the service. The setting accepting unit accepts a setting for an operation of the image processing apparatus requested by the operation request. The payment control unit makes a payment for the operation of the image processing apparatus requested by the operation request through an electronic payment system available on the chat service. The operation execution control unit controls the image processing apparatus to execute the operation requested by the operation request after the setting is accepted by the setting accepting unit and the payment is made by the payment control unit.

Image forming apparatus that installs applications, control method therefor, and storage medium
An image forming apparatus which is capable of appropriately producing displays using installed expansion application modules without using a window manager module. The image forming apparatus produces a display in accordance with a display instruction for at least one of the installed expansion application modules. When display instructions for the expansion application modules overlap each other, priorities for display are assigned based on starting conditions related to the expansion application modules.
IMAGE FORMING APPARATUS CAPABLE OF ALLOCATING MEMORY CAPACITY OF MEMORY AMONG AND DEPENDING ON DIFFERENT TYPES OF PROCESSING CONSTITUTING JOB TO CREATE PLURALITY OF MEMORY REGIONS IN MEMORY
An image forming apparatus includes a memory, a control device, and an image forming device. The control device includes a processor and functions as a memory manager and a controller through the processor executing a control program. The memory manager allocates amounts of the memory depending on different types of processing constituting a job to create a plurality of memory regions. The controller executes the job using at least one of the plurality of memory regions. The image forming device executes an image forming job of forming an image on a sheet under control of the controller.
SIGNATURE SYSTEM, AND NON-TRANSITORY COMPUTER-READABLE RECORDING MEDIUM THEREFOR
A signature system includes an applicant side device and an approver side device. A full-application is installed in the applicant side device, an applicant generate, using the full-application, an expense report in which a signature field and a mark for starting up a mini application is included and print the same using a printer. An approver receives the printed expense report read the mark included in the expense report using the approver side device, thereby downloads the mini application from a server and starts up the same. Then, the approver approves the expense report on the mini application.

Mobile information terminal and image forming apparatus capable of carrying out near-field wireless communication, system, control method therefor, and storage medium
A system which enables an image forming apparatus to give priority to executing a job sent from a mobile information terminal. The mobile information terminal sets an operating mode of the image forming apparatus. When a near-field wireless communication is started by the mobile information terminal coming close to the image forming apparatus, information on the set operating mode is sent to the image forming apparatus. The image forming apparatus provides operating mode shifting control based on the information on the operating mode sent from the mobile information terminal by the near-field wireless communication.
